The components or substances that make up our blood are present in a certain proportion. In the field of hematology, researches have been carried out on blood values of people from past to present, the rates of blood components have been determined and standard values have been established. Standard fasting periods play a decisive role in these values. Blood values within the standard are accepted as “Normal Values”. Blood values below or above this standard are a sign that something is wrong in the body. While these indicators are not always sufficient to make a definitive diagnosis, they provide clear insights and help navigate the correct trail for diagnosis. In line with these ideas, doctors make tests that confirm the diagnosis and enlighten the patient and start the treatment process as soon as possible.
What Are Hematology Tests and Their Meanings?
Hematology assays; It consists of Hemogram (Complete Blood Count), Sedimentation and Coagulation tests. These tests are carried out in sterile environments that are free from microorganisms. Blood is taken from individuals with the help of a disposable syringe and transferred to labeled tubes. These tubes are labeled according to the type of test to be made and sent to the laboratory that will conduct research. Hematology tests are quick results. The results are in the hands of people in a very short time.
It is best to take blood samples on an empty stomach and in the morning. The blood values taken on a full stomach will appear high and will be misleading in the doctor’s diagnosis. The fact that the cures that will affect blood values have not been used recently is important for the clarity of the results.
